Volume 2132 is the proceedings of 31st International Symposium on Rarefied Gas Dynamics (23–27 July 2018, Glasgow, UK)

Title information

The 31st International Symposium on Rarefied Gas Dynamics continued a series of events that began in 1958. The symposium focused on the research and technological development in the area associated with rarefied gas dynamics. These proceedings include papers from world-leading researchers and technology developers. Some examples of the specific topics are gas kinetic theory; numerical methods; DSMC, molecular dynamics, and other particle methods; vacuum technology; plasma flows and processes; micro/nano flows; space vehicle aerodynamics; granular flows; jets and plumes; and non-equilibrium reacting flows.
